Beyond the Assembly Line Mentality

Automation, in its rudimentary form, might conjure images of factory floors and repetitive tasks. Hyperautomation transcends this limited scope. It’s about applying automation across the entire organization, from interactions to back-office operations, from marketing campaigns to supply chain management.

It’s not just about replacing human tasks with machines; it’s about augmenting human capabilities, freeing up valuable time for strategic thinking and creative problem-solving. For an SMB, this shift can be transformative, allowing them to compete with larger entities without the need for massive capital investments or bloated payrolls.

Leveling the Playing Field

Consider a local bakery, struggling to manage online orders, inventory, and customer inquiries alongside the daily grind of baking. Before hyperautomation, they might hire more staff, increasing overhead and complexity. Hyperautomation offers an alternative. Imagine AI-powered chatbots handling customer queries, robotic process automation (RPA) managing inventory levels, and intelligent business process management suites streamlining order fulfillment.

Suddenly, this small bakery can handle volumes previously unimaginable, competing effectively with larger chains that have traditionally dominated the market. This isn’t just about cutting costs; it’s about unlocking potential, allowing SMBs to punch above their weight class.

Addressing the Skepticism

For many SMB owners, the term “hyperautomation” might sound intimidating, a concept reserved for tech giants with deep pockets. There’s a perception that automation is expensive, complex, and requires specialized expertise. This perception, while understandable, overlooks the democratizing trend in technology.

Cloud-based automation tools, low-code platforms, and readily available AI solutions are making hyperautomation accessible and affordable for businesses of all sizes. The initial investment, while present, is often offset by long-term gains in efficiency, productivity, and competitiveness.

Starting Small, Thinking Big

SMBs don’t need to overhaul their entire operations overnight to embrace hyperautomation. A phased approach is often more practical and effective. Start by identifying pain points ● areas where processes are slow, error-prone, or resource-intensive. Perhaps it’s invoice processing, customer onboarding, or social media management.

Pilot projects in these areas can demonstrate the tangible benefits of automation and build internal momentum. The key is to start with achievable goals, learn from each implementation, and gradually expand the scope of automation across the business. This iterative approach minimizes risk and maximizes the chances of successful hyperautomation adoption.

The Human Element Remains

Concerns about automation replacing human jobs are valid, but in the SMB context, hyperautomation is more about augmenting human capabilities than outright replacement. It’s about freeing employees from mundane, repetitive tasks so they can focus on activities that require creativity, critical thinking, and emotional intelligence ● areas where humans excel. In fact, hyperautomation can create new, higher-value roles within SMBs, focusing on managing automation systems, analyzing data, and driving strategic initiatives. The human element remains central; it simply shifts from task execution to strategic oversight and innovation.

Reimagining Business Processes Through An Automation Lens

A common pitfall for SMBs venturing into hyperautomation is simply automating existing inefficient processes. True necessitates a fundamental rethinking of business processes. It’s about asking ● “If we were to design this process from scratch, leveraging the full power of automation, what would it look like?” This involves process mining to identify bottlenecks and inefficiencies, process re-engineering to optimize workflows for automation, and a willingness to challenge long-held assumptions about how work gets done. For instance, a traditional sales process might involve manual data entry, disjointed communication channels, and lengthy lead times.

A hyperautomated sales process could leverage AI-powered CRM systems, automated lead nurturing workflows, and analytics to personalize customer interactions and accelerate deal closures. This isn’t just about speed; it’s about creating a fundamentally superior and a more agile sales engine.

Data-Driven Decision Making Amplified

Hyperautomation generates vast amounts of data ● data about process performance, customer behavior, operational bottlenecks, and market trends. For SMBs, this data goldmine can be transformative, but only if it’s effectively harnessed. Intermediate-level focus on integrating and business intelligence tools to extract actionable insights from this data. Imagine a small e-commerce business using hyperautomation to manage its online store.

By analyzing data from automated order processing, customer interactions, and inventory management systems, they can identify best-selling products, optimize pricing strategies, personalize marketing campaigns, and predict future demand with greater accuracy. This data-driven approach moves decision-making from gut feeling to evidence-based strategies, significantly enhancing competitiveness and reducing risk.

Measuring Hyperautomation Success Beyond Roi

Return on Investment (ROI) is a crucial metric for any business investment, including hyperautomation. However, focusing solely on short-term ROI can limit the strategic potential of hyperautomation. Intermediate-level strategies broaden the scope of success measurement to include qualitative benefits and long-term strategic impact. Metrics such as customer satisfaction, employee engagement, process agility, and time-to-market become equally important indicators of hyperautomation success.

For example, automating customer service interactions might not immediately translate into direct cost savings, but it can significantly improve customer satisfaction and loyalty, leading to increased repeat business and positive word-of-mouth referrals ● benefits that are harder to quantify but strategically invaluable. A balanced scorecard approach, incorporating both quantitative and qualitative metrics, provides a more holistic view of hyperautomation’s true value and strategic contribution to SMB growth.

Navigating The Evolving Regulatory Landscape

As hyperautomation becomes more pervasive, regulatory considerations are becoming increasingly important, particularly regarding data privacy, security, and usage. SMBs must proactively address these regulatory aspects to mitigate risks and maintain customer trust. This involves implementing robust data governance policies, ensuring compliance with regulations such as GDPR and CCPA, and adopting ethical AI principles in automation design and deployment. For instance, using AI-powered chatbots for customer service requires careful consideration of data privacy and transparency.

Ensuring that chatbots are transparent about their AI nature, protecting customer data, and providing human fallback options are crucial for building trust and complying with evolving regulations. Proactive regulatory compliance is not just a legal obligation; it’s a strategic differentiator that enhances and long-term sustainability.

The Algorithmic Enterprise Smb Transformation

Advanced hyperautomation propels SMBs towards becoming algorithmic enterprises ● organizations where decision-making, operations, and customer interactions are increasingly driven by algorithms and intelligent automation systems. This transformation extends beyond automating individual tasks; it involves embedding intelligence into core business processes, creating self-optimizing systems that learn, adapt, and proactively respond to changing market conditions. Consider a small logistics company adopting advanced hyperautomation. Instead of relying on manual route planning and dispatching, they implement AI-powered logistics platforms that dynamically optimize routes based on real-time traffic data, weather conditions, and delivery schedules.

Furthermore, predictive analytics algorithms anticipate potential disruptions, enabling proactive rerouting and minimizing delays. This algorithmic approach not only enhances efficiency but also creates a more resilient and responsive logistics network, providing a significant competitive edge in a dynamic market. The SMB is characterized by agility, data-driven insights, and a capacity for continuous self-improvement, fundamentally altering the competitive landscape.

Dynamic Value Chain Orchestration Through Hyperautomation

Traditional value chains are often linear and static. Advanced hyperautomation enables orchestration, where SMBs can create fluid, adaptive, and interconnected ecosystems of partners, suppliers, and customers. This involves leveraging technologies like blockchain, IoT, and AI to create transparent, real-time visibility across the entire value chain, enabling seamless collaboration, optimized resource allocation, and rapid response to disruptions. Imagine a small fashion brand leveraging hyperautomation to orchestrate its global supply chain.

Using blockchain technology, they can track the journey of raw materials from origin to finished product, ensuring ethical sourcing and transparency for consumers. IoT sensors embedded in garments provide real-time data on inventory levels and customer demand, enabling dynamic production adjustments and minimizing waste. AI-powered platforms facilitate seamless communication and collaboration with suppliers and distributors, creating a responsive and agile value chain that can adapt quickly to changing fashion trends and market demands. This dynamic value chain orchestration fosters resilience, efficiency, and enhanced customer value, creating a significant competitive advantage in globalized markets.

Ethical And Responsible Hyperautomation Deployment

As hyperautomation becomes more deeply integrated into SMB operations and customer interactions, ethical and responsible deployment becomes paramount. Advanced strategies emphasize fairness, transparency, accountability, and human oversight in automation design and implementation. This involves addressing potential biases in algorithms, ensuring data privacy and security, mitigating job displacement concerns, and maintaining human-in-the-loop control for critical decision-making processes. Consider a small healthcare provider implementing AI-powered diagnostic tools.

Ethical considerations demand rigorous testing and validation of algorithms to ensure accuracy and minimize biases. Transparent communication with patients about the use of AI in diagnosis is crucial for building trust. Robust measures are essential to protect sensitive patient information. Human clinicians must retain ultimate oversight and decision-making authority in critical diagnostic cases. Ethical and responsible hyperautomation deployment is not merely a compliance requirement; it’s a strategic imperative for building sustainable trust, maintaining social license to operate, and fostering long-term competitive advantage.
